Output ec9d5a689ab401329145fc23b1cba9df2590ad50e5f597da9b9b90ec3a00c950:2
- value
- 2384552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8355ed367f3d736683dc199788929dfdc60c29b9 OP_EQUAL
- address
- 3DfTNxbDMXYPDSNPdZ51tx8TCoxbknEKPJ
- transaction
- ec9d5a689ab401329145fc23b1cba9df2590ad50e5f597da9b9b90ec3a00c950
- confirmations
- 250887
- spent
- true